Fawkes & Reece London is hiring a Telehandler for a full-time temporary position in Ashford, with ongoing responsibilities and a pay rate ranging from £17 to £18 per hour. You will be responsible for transporting materials around the site, loading and unloading goods from vehicles, and performing daily equipment checks.
The ideal candidate will have a current CPCS (blue) card or NPORS CSCS ticket, along with over 3 years of operating experience. A working knowledge of health & safety procedures is advantageous.
